Skip to content

Commit

Permalink
acme module: update for simp_le v0.8
Browse files Browse the repository at this point in the history
Hopefully fixes #37689
  • Loading branch information
wmertens committed Mar 24, 2018
1 parent 62b3507 commit 527e97f
Showing 1 changed file with 1 addition and 9 deletions.
10 changes: 1 addition & 9 deletions nixos/modules/security/acme.nix
Expand Up @@ -140,14 +140,6 @@ in
'';
};

tosHash = mkOption {
type = types.string;
default = "cc88d8d9517f490191401e7b54e9ffd12a2b9082ec7a1d4cec6101f9f1647e7b";
description = ''
SHA256 of the Terms of Services document. This changes once in a while.
'';
};

production = mkOption {
type = types.bool;
default = true;
Expand Down Expand Up @@ -196,7 +188,7 @@ in
let
cpath = "${cfg.directory}/${cert}";
rights = if data.allowKeysForGroup then "750" else "700";
cmdline = [ "-v" "-d" data.domain "--default_root" data.webroot "--valid_min" cfg.validMin "--tos_sha256" cfg.tosHash ]
cmdline = [ "-v" "-d" data.domain "--default_root" data.webroot "--valid_min" cfg.validMin ]
++ optionals (data.email != null) [ "--email" data.email ]
++ concatMap (p: [ "-f" p ]) data.plugins
++ concatLists (mapAttrsToList (name: root: [ "-d" (if root == null then name else "${name}:${root}")]) data.extraDomains)
Expand Down

0 comments on commit 527e97f

Please sign in to comment.